Tough stains happen—coffee spills, oily splashes, makeup smudges, grass marks. The good news? Most stains can be removed safely when you follow the right order: act fast, pre-treat correctly, wash smart, and avoid heat until the stain is gone.

This guide gives you a simple, fabric-friendly method you can use on whites and colors—plus a stain-by-stain playbook you can save for later.


A quick method that works for most stains

Step 1 — Identify the stain (and the fabric).Check the care label first. Delicates, wool, and silk need gentler handling than cotton or synthetics.

Step 2 — Act fast. Blot liquids with a clean towel. For many stains, rinse from the back of the fabric with cool water to push the stain out (not deeper in).

Step 3 — Pre-treat before washing.Pre-treatment is where you win the battle. Apply a stain remover to the affected area and let it work before the wash.

Step 4 — Wash smart and re-check. Wash based on the care label. Do not tumble dry until the stain is fully gone—heat can “set” stains permanently.

The Tough-Stain Playbook (what to do + what to avoid)

1) Oil & Grease (cooking oil, butter, sauces)

Do this:

  • Blot excess oil (don’t rub).

  • Pre-treat the stain before washing.

  • Wash in the warmest temperature allowed by the fabric label.

Avoid:

  • Hot ironing or drying before the stain disappears.

2) Coffee & Tea

Do this:

  • Rinse with cool water immediately.

  • Pre-treat, then wash as usual.

Avoid:

  • Letting it sit dry for hours—time makes tannin stains tougher.

3) Makeup (foundation, lipstick)

Do this:

  • Gently lift product residue with a soft cloth.

  • Pre-treat, then wash.

Avoid:

  • Aggressive scrubbing (can spread pigments).

4) Grass & Mud

Do this:

  • Let mud dry, then brush off gently.

  • Pre-treat and wash.

Avoid:

  • Rubbing wet mud—it pushes particles deeper into fibers.

5) Blood

Do this:

  • Use cold water only.

  • Pre-treat, then wash on a cool cycle if needed.

Avoid:

  • Warm/hot water (it can set protein stains).

6) Tomato / Red Sauce

Do this:

  • Remove excess sauce.

  • Rinse from the back of the fabric.

  • Pre-treat and wash.

Avoid:

  • Heat before the stain is gone.

Pro tips for consistently better results

  • Pre-treat first, wash second (not the other way around).

  • Work from the back of the fabric when rinsing.

  • Don’t mix random chemicals—stick to product directions.

  • Check before drying—heat locks stains in.
